2017-04-12 98 views
-1

Spring框架優勢之一是依賴注入。許多人使用SpringBoot來提供REST Web服務。SpringBoot可以用於後端應用程序嗎?

閱讀起來,並注意有計劃和CommandLineRunner爲SpringBoot,我們可以使用SpringBoot爲後端應用程序類型,以取代通常的獨立的Java程序,同時還可使用SpringBoot優勢(依賴注入) - cron作業運行(執行和停止運行) - 長時間運行過程

我正在研究的一個主要問題是在後端應用程序中使用註釋,如Spring配置,Spring Data JPA和其他技術。

回答

1

當然!

我用spring引導來備份CLI項目,數據庫訪問項目等等。

春季啓動非常模塊化。它通過提供基於maven/gradle導入的自動配置來工作。如果您沒有導入starter-web/starter-jersey或任何其他starter這是爲網絡/休息api,此資源的自動配置將不會被觸發,您可以基本上享受所有的彈簧引導的力量,以支持您的需求

0

當然, Spring引導不是一個單獨的框架,它減少了使用spring框架時的配置困難。 Spring引導提供了一種快速應用程序開發,不需要複雜的配置,包括調度程序servlet,用於數據庫連接和配置文件的XML文件。您可以使用彈簧引導進行後端開發。簡單地說,你可以在沒有任何複雜配置的情況下完成你在Spring MVC中所做的一切。如果您使用的是spring引導,則可以在application.properties文件中配置數據庫詳細信息。我加入的兩個環節進行適當的閱讀一個,

https://projects.spring.io/spring-boot/https://dzone.com/articles/why-springboot

相關問題